Prior to strut mount replacement, follow the procedure outlined below to test strut mount vertical/lateral movement on subject vehicles equipped with
single path strut mounts.
Strut Mount Vertical Clearance
1.. Position the vehicle on a frame contact hoist so that the weight of the wheel assemblies hang freely. This should allow the strut rebound retainer to
contact the strut mount.
FIG. 1 - Strut Mount & Record
2.
Using a scale, measure the distance between the rebound retainer and the strut mount and record (Figure 1).
3.
Lower the vehicle completely to the floor with the vehicle weight on all four wheels. Again measure the distance between the strut rebound
retainer and the strut mount in the same location as in Step 2.
NOTE:
DO NOT LEAN ON VEHICLE WHEN MAKING THIS MEASUREMENT.
4.
The difference in the two measurements is the strut mount vertical clearance.
